James Jenkins Lake Dam

James Jenkins Lake Dam is an earth dam located in Monroe County, Mississippi. It carries a Low hazard potential classification.

About James Jenkins Lake Dam

The primary purpose of James Jenkins Lake Dam is recreation. The dam creates a reservoir used for recreational activities such as fishing, boating, and swimming. The dam is private-owned.

The dam stands 40 feet tall, and has a maximum storage capacity of 270 acre-feet.

This dam has a low hazard potential classification, meaning that failure would cause minimal damage, limited primarily to the dam owner's property, with no expected loss of life.

At 40 feet, this dam is taller than 87% of dams nationwide.
